(1985-1990)

Logo: On a black background, a primitive looking "Ci" model (similar to the T1P (TVP1) model) is seen rotating around many times with light flares. The model then stops and a blue dot appears on the I. The dot engulfs the entire screen while the words "Contal International Ltd." are seen rotating around it 2 times and then finally stop in the middle.

Technique: Mostly live-action for Ci model rotating, and 2D animation for the dot and company name.

Music/Sounds: A piano tune when the Ci model is rotating, then a descending synthesized tune.

Availability: Extremely rare.
